  • Patent number: 8291698
    Abstract: The sound insulation cover includes: a cover member 21 that is externally mounted on an exhaust manifold and that insulates transmission of noises to the outside; and a fixing means 22 that is combined with an opening 21a formed in the cover member 21 in correspondence to a fixing portion 18a of the exhaust manifold and that fixes the cover member 21 to the fixing portion 18a of the exhaust manifold. The fixing means 22 has: a ring-shaped cover holding plate 23 fixed to the cover member 21 along the edge portion of the opening 21a of the cover member 21; and a disk-shaped plate 24 fixed to the fixing portion 18a of the exhaust manifold. The inner peripheral portion of the cover holding plate 23 and the outer peripheral portion of the fixing plate 24 are formed into a ring-shaped depressed-projected fit portion 25.

  • Patent number: 8220800
    Abstract: To provide a seal layer-transferred metal gasket that can effectively prevent degradation in seal performance due to the wearing and peeling of the coating layer. A head gasket is interposed between a cylinder block and a cylinder head. In the metal gasket seal layers made by laminating a separation layer, a coating layer and an adhesive layer in this order from the bead sheet side is formed at least on the surface of the bead sheet facing the cylinder block and the cylinder head, and, in a state where the head gasket is interposed between the cylinder block and the cylinder head and the three objects are closely attached to each other, the adhesive layer is adhered to the seal target members, and at least some portions of the coating layer and adhesive layer are separated from the bead sheet with a boundary at the separation layer and then transferred to the seal areas of the cylinder block and cylinder head.
